HEX
Server: LiteSpeed
System: Linux shams.tasjeel.ae 5.14.0-611.5.1.el9_7.x86_64 #1 SMP PREEMPT_DYNAMIC Tue Nov 11 08:09:09 EST 2025 x86_64
User: infowars (1469)
PHP: 8.2.29
Disabled: NONE
Upload Files
File: //proc/self/root/lib/python3.9/site-packages/pyasn1_modules/__pycache__/rfc5755.cpython-39.pyc
a

�2�]1/�@s�ddlmZddlmZddlmZddlmZddlmZddlmZddlmZddlmZdd	l	m
Z
dd
l	mZed�Z
iZejZe
jZe
jZe
jZe
jZe
jZe
jZe
jZe
jZe
jZe
jZe
jZe�d�Zed
ZedZedZedZ e�d�Z!e�d�Z"Gdd�dej#�Z$Gdd�dej%�Z&Gdd�dej%�Z'Gdd�dej%�Z(Gdd�dej%�Z)Gdd�dej*�Z+Gdd �d ej%�Z,Gd!d"�d"ej%�Z-Gd#d$�d$ej%�Z.ed%Z/e"d&Z0e"d'Z1Gd(d)�d)ej%�Z2Gd*d+�d+ej*�Z3Gd,d-�d-ej4�Z5edZ6Gd.d/�d/ej4�Z7ed0Z8Gd1d2�d2ej4�Z9Gd3d4�d4ej%�Z:ed
Z;ed5Z<Gd6d7�d7ej%�Z=edZ>ed%Z?Gd8d9�d9ej%�Z@e!d:ZAGd;d<�d<ej%�ZBGd=d>�d>ejC�ZDGd?d@�d@ej%�ZEe�dA�ZFGdBdC�dCej%�ZGe�dD�ZHGdEdF�dFej%�ZIed0ZJGdGdH�dHej%�ZKe/e�L�e0e�M�e1e5�e6e7�e8e:�iZNe
jO�PeN�e;e=�e<e=�e>e@�e?e@�eAeB�eFeG�eHeI�eJe�iZQe
jR�PeQ�dIS)J�)�char)�
constraint)�	namedtype)�namedval)�opentype)�tag)�univ)�useful)�rfc5280)�rfc5652�inf)���r
�r�)r
)r)�
)�0)�r�)rr�c@seZdZe�d�ZdS)�AttCertVersion)Zv2r
N��__name__�
__module__�__qualname__r�NamedValues�namedValues�rr�:/usr/lib/python3.9/site-packages/pyasn1_modules/rfc5755.pyrTs�rc@s8eZdZe�e�de��e�de��e�de	���Z
dS)�IssuerSerial�issuer�serialZ	issuerUIDN)rrrr�
NamedTypes�	NamedType�GeneralNames�CertificateSerialNumber�OptionalNamedType�UniqueIdentifier�
componentTyperrrrr Zs
�r c@sXeZdZe�e�deje�	ddd�d��e�
de���e�de��e�de�
���Zd	S)
�ObjectDigestInfoZdigestedObjectType)Z	publicKeyr)Z
publicKeyCertr
)ZotherObjectTypesr)rZotherObjectTypeIDZdigestAlgorithmZobjectDigestN)rrrrr#r$rZ
Enumeratedrrr'�ObjectIdentifier�AlgorithmIdentifier�	BitStringr)rrrrr*bs$������r*c
@szeZdZe�e�de�je�	ej
ejd�d��e�de�je�	ej
ej
d�d��e�de�je�	ej
ejd�d���ZdS)	�Holder�baseCertificateIDr�ZimplicitTagZ
entityNamer
�objectDigestInforN)rrrrr#r'r �subtyper�Tag�tagClassContext�tagFormatConstructedr%�tagFormatSimpler*r)rrrrr.rs"

��

��

���r.c
@sdeZdZe�e�de��e�de�je	�
e	je	jd�d��e�de
�je	�
e	je	jd�d���ZdS)�V2FormZ
issuerNamer/rr0r1r
N)rrrrr#r'r%r r2rr3r4r5r*r)rrrrr7�s�

��

���r7c@sBeZdZe�e�de��e�de�je	�
e	je	jd�d���Z
dS)�
AttCertIssuerZv1FormZv2Formrr0N)rrrrr#r$r%r7r2rr3r4r5r)rrrrr8�s
��r8c@s0eZdZe�e�de���e�de����ZdS)�AttCertValidityPeriodZ
notBeforeTimeZnotAfterTimeN)	rrrrr#r$r	ZGeneralizedTimer)rrrrr9�s�r9c@s�eZdZe�e�de��e�de��e�de��e�de	��e�de
��e�de��e�dej
e�d��e�d	e��e�d
e���	ZdS)�AttributeCertificateInfo�versionZholderr!Z	signatureZserialNumberZattrCertValidityPeriodZ
attributes�r)ZissuerUniqueID�
extensionsN)rrrrr#r$rr.r8r,r&r9r�
SequenceOf�	Attributer'r(�
Extensionsr)rrrrr:�s:����������r:c	@s:eZdZe�e�de��e�de��e�de�	���Z
dS)�AttributeCertificateZacinfoZsignatureAlgorithmZsignatureValueN)rrrrr#r$r:r,rr-r)rrrrrA�s
�rA)r)�8)�7c@s8eZdZe�e�de��e�de��e�de	���Z
dS)�
TargetCertZtargetCertificate�
targetNameZcertDigestInfoN)rrrrr#r$r r'�GeneralNamer*r)rrrrrD�s
�rDc
@szeZdZe�e�de�je�	ej
ejd�d��e�de�je�	ej
ejd�d��e�de�je�	ej
ej
d�d���ZdS)	�TargetrErr0ZtargetGroupr
Z
targetCertrN)rrrrr#r$rFr2rr3r4r6rDr5r)rrrrrG�s"

��

��

���rGc@seZdZe�ZdS)�TargetsN)rrrrGr)rrrrrH�srHc@seZdZe�ZdS)�	ProxyInfoN)rrrrHr)rrrrrI�srI)rc@seZdZe��ZdS)�AttrSpecN)rrrrr+r)rrrrrJ�srJc
@s�eZdZe�e�de��je	�
de�d��e�de�je
�e
je
jd�d��e�de�je
�e
je
jd�d��e�de��jdd	���Zd
S)�
AAControlsZpathLenConstraintr)ZsubtypeSpecZpermittedAttrsr0Z
excludedAttrsr
ZpermitUnSpecified��valueN)rrrrr#r'r�Integerr2rZValueRangeConstraint�MAXrJrr3r4r6�DefaultedNamedTypeZBooleanr)rrrrrK�s(
��

��

����rK)rc	@s:eZdZe�e�de��e�de��e�de�	���Z
dS)�SvceAuthInfoZservice�identZauthInfoN)rrrrr#r$rFr'r�OctetStringr)rrrrrQs
�rQc@s~eZdZe�e�de�je�	ej
ejd�d��e�de
je
je�e�de
���e�de
���e�de����d�d���Zd	S)
�IetfAttrSyntaxZpolicyAuthorityrr0�valuesZoctetsZoid�stringr<N)rrrrr#r'r%r2rr3r4r6r$rr>�ChoicerSr+rZ
UTF8Stringr)rrrrrTs

��
���rT)�Hc@sXeZdZe�e�de�je�	ej
ejd�d��e�de
�je�	ej
ejd�d���ZdS)�
RoleSyntaxZ
roleAuthorityrr0ZroleNamer
N)rrrrr#r'r%r2rr3r4r6r$rFr)rrrrrY$s

��

���rYc@s eZdZe�dddddd�ZdS)�	ClassList)Zunmarkedr)�unclassifiedr
)Z
restrictedr)Zconfidentialr)Zsecretr)Z	topSecretrNrrrrrrZ/s�rZc@sheZdZe�e�de��je	�
e	je	jd�d��ejde�
�je	�
e	je	jd�d�e�de�d��ZdS)�SecurityCategory�typerr0rMr
)ZopenTypeN)rrrrr#r$rr+r2rr3r4r6�AnyrZOpenType�securityCategoryMapr)rrrrr\:s
��
�
��r\)rrrrCc
@sJeZdZe�e�de���e�de	�j
dd��e�deje
�d���ZdS)�	Clearance�policyId�	classListr[rL�securityCategoriesr<N)rrrrr#r$rr+rPrZr2r'�SetOfr\r)rrrrr`Is����r`)rrr
rrCc
@s�eZdZe�e�de��je	�
e	je	jd�d��e�
de�je	�
e	je	jd�d�jdd��e�deje�d	�je	�
e	je	jd
�d���ZdS)�Clearance_rfc3281rarr0rbr
r[rLrcr<rN)rrrrr#r$rr+r2rr3r4r6rPrZr'rdr\r)rrrrreWs*
��

���
����rec
@sBeZdZe�e�de��e�de���e�dej	e
�d���ZdS)�ACClearAttrsZacIssuerZacSerial�attrsr<N)rrrrr#r$rFrrNr>r?r)rrrrrfjs
�rfN)SZpyasn1.typerrrrrrrr	Zpyasn1_modulesr
r�floatrOr_ZContentInfor,r?ZAuthorityInfoAccessSyntaxZAuthorityKeyIdentifierr&ZCRLDistributionPointsr@Z	Extensionr%rFr(r+Zid_pkixZid_peZid_kpZid_acaZid_adZid_atZid_cerNr�Sequencer r*r.r7rWr8r9r:rAZid_pe_ac_auditIdentityZid_ce_noRevAvailZid_ce_targetInformationrDrGr>rHZid_pe_ac_proxyingrIZid_pe_aaControlsrJrKZid_aca_authenticationInfoZid_aca_accessIdentityrQZid_aca_chargingIdentityZid_aca_grouprTZ
id_at_rolerYr-rZr\Zid_at_clearancer`Zid_at_clearance_rfc3281reZid_aca_encAttrsrfrSZNullZ_certificateExtensionsMapUpdateZcertificateExtensionsMap�updateZ_certificateAttributesMapUpdateZcertificateAttributesMaprrrr�<module>s�






��